  2. How long is the train trip from Bergisch Gladbach to Amsterdam?

    A train trip between Bergisch Gladbach and Amsterdam is around 4h, although the fastest train will take about 3h 52m. This is the time it takes to travel the 138 miles that separates the two cities.

  3. How many daily train are there between Bergisch Gladbach and Amsterdam?

    The number of trains from Bergisch Gladbach to Amsterdam can differ depending on the day of the week. On average, there are 6. Some trains are direct while others include transferring trains. Did you know?

Japanese trains are always on time. It is extremely infrequent to see breakdowns during peak periods. In the event of a delay of more than 5 minutes, the crew will personally apologise to each passenger.

The magnetic levitation train (Maglev for short) is currently the fastest train in the world. With a speed of 603 km/ h, it is closely followed by the French high-speed train (574.8 km / h) which remains in 2020, the fastest train to date

New York holds the record for the most platforms and track numbers in a single station. Grand Central Station in Manhattan is one of the largest rail terminals in the world with more than 44 platforms and 67 tracks to accommodate passengers.
